Offensive formations
Prior to the ball is snapped the offensive team lines up in a development. Most teams Have a very "base" formation they like to line up in, whilst other groups leave the protection guessing. Groups will typically have "Specific formations" which they only use in noticeable passing predicaments, short yardage or goaline situations, or formations they may have formulated for that specific match just to confuse the defense. Simply because you'll find an almost unlimited amount of achievable formations, only a few of the additional popular kinds are detailed beneath.
Pro Established
The Pro Set is a conventional development usually, a "foundation" established used by Skilled and novice teams. The formation has two large receivers, one particular limited stop, and two managing backs With all the backs break up powering the quarterback, who is lined up at the rear of Centre. The jogging backs are lined up aspect-by-aspect in lieu of a person before one other as in traditional I-Development sets.
Shotgun formation
The Shotgun formation is really an alignment utilized by the offensive team in American and Canadian soccer. This development is utilized by several teams in noticeable passing cases, Whilst other groups do use this as their base development. In the shotgun, as an alternative to the quarterback receiving the snap from Centre at the line of scrimmage, he stands at least five yards back again. Occasionally the quarterback will likely have a back on a single or each side ahead of the snap, while other periods he will be the lone player during the backfield with All people distribute out as receivers. One of the advantages of the shotgun development are which the passer has a lot more Check out here time to build during the pocket which supplies him a next or two to Identify open receivers. A further gain is standing even more back from the line before the snap offers the quarterback a greater "appear" on the defensive alignment. The cons are the protection is aware a pass is greater than very likely arising (While some jogging performs can be run efficiently in the shotgun) and there's a higher hazard of the botched snap than in an easy Centre/quarterback exchange.
The formation obtained its identify immediately after it was used by a professional soccer club, the San Francisco 49ers, in 1960. Combining elements on the small punt and distribute formations ("distribute" in that it had receivers unfold broadly as an alternative to near or powering the inside line players), it was said being like a "shotgun" in spraying receivers around the industry just like a scatter-shot gun. Quick punt formations (so called simply because the gap between the snapper plus the ostensible punter is shorter than in lengthy punt formation) Will not normally have just as much emphasis on broad receivers.
Occasionally the formation has long been more typical in Canadian soccer, which allows only a few downs to move 10 yards downfield in lieu of the American recreation's four. Canadian groups are consequently more very likely to discover themselves with extended yardage to produce to the penultimate down, and therefore far more likely to line up within the shotgun to increase their chances for a considerable obtain. Groups like the Saskatchewan Roughriders utilize the shotgun for any overwhelming majority in their performs.
Wishbone development
The wishbone formation, also regarded simply as 'bone, can be a Engage in development in American football.
The wishbone is principally a functioning development with one particular broad receiver, a single tight conclude and 3 jogging backs at the rear of the quarterback (who takes the snap below Centre). The back lined up at the rear of the quarterback may be the fullback and one other two are halfbacks (While they may be referred to as tailbacks or I backs in a few playbook terminology).
The wishbone is commonly affiliated with the choice as this formation will allow the quarterback to simply run the option to possibly side of the line. It's also ideal for operating the triple selection.
History
The wishbone was produced by Offensive Coordinator Emory Bellard and Head Mentor Darrell Royal in the College of Texas in 1968. Mentor Royal was constantly a supporter of the option offense, and in investigating the personnel over the crew, Mentor Bellard observed 3 good working backs. Just after experimenting with relations around the summer months, Coach Bellard came up with the formation.
Mentor Bellard shown the development to Darrell Royal, who immediately embraced The thought. It proved being a sensible selection: Texas tied its 1st video game functioning the new offense, shed the next, and after that won another thirty straight online games, resulting in two Countrywide Championships using the formation.
It absolutely was presented the identify wishbone from the Houston Chronicle sportswriter Mickey Herskowitz.
A variation to this formation is called the flexbone.
I formation
The I development is One of the more popular offensive formations in American football. The I development attracts its identify through the vertical (as seen through the opposing endzone) alignment of quarterback, fullback, and managing back, particularly when contrasted Using the very same players' alignments inside the now-archaic T development.
The formation starts with the usual 5 offensive linemen (two offensive tackles, two guards, as well as a Heart), the quarterback beneath Centre, and two backs Indianapolis Colts jerseys in-line driving the quarterback. The base variant adds a tight end to one side of the road and two extensive receivers, just one at Each and every conclude of the line.
Regular roles
The I development is often used in operating situations. The fullback usually fills a blocking, rather than dashing or obtaining, purpose in the fashionable recreation. With the fullback in the backfield as being a blocker, operates can be produced to possibly side of the road with his added blocking guidance. This is often contrasted with the use of restricted finishes as blockers who, remaining arrange at the conclusion of the road, will be able to guidance operates to 1 facet of the line only. The fullback can be utilised as a feint--since the protection can spot him additional quickly than the running back, They might be drawn in his course whilst the jogging again usually takes the ball the alternative way.
Despite the emphasis over the working game, the I development remains a good foundation for a passing assault. The formation supports up to a few wide receivers and several operating backs function yet another receiving threat. When the fullback isn't a pass receiver, he serves as a capable supplemental pass blocker safeguarding the quarterback prior to the pass. The managing threat posed via the development also lends alone towards the Participate in-motion move. The adaptable mother nature on the development also assists prevent defenses from focusing their awareness on possibly the operate or move.
Prevalent versions
A lot of subtypes with the I formation exist, normally emphasizing the operating or passing strengths of The bottom version.
* The Big I spots a decent end on either side on the offensive line (eliminating a large receiver). Coupled Together with the fullback's blocking, this allows two further blockers for any operate in both route. This can be a running-emphasis variant.
* The ability I replaces a person large receiver with a 3rd back (fullback or operating back) in the backfield, create to one aspect of the fullback. It is a working-emphasis variant.
* The Jumbo or Goal-line development even further extends the Power I or Big I, adding a 2nd or third limited conclude to the road, respectively. This variant has no broad receivers which is all but exclusively a running development meant to reliably gain nominal yardage, most commonly two yards or less.
* The Three-large I replaces the tight end with a third huge receiver. This is a passing-emphasis variant.
The I formation, in any variant, will also be modified as Powerful or Weak. In possibly circumstance, the fullback lines up approximately a yard laterally to his typical place. Strong refers to your transfer in the direction of the aspect of the quarterback with extra gamers, weak in the alternative way. These modifications have tiny effect on anticipated Enjoy get in touch with.
In Expert Soccer
During the NFL, the I development is much less routinely employed than in university, as using the fullback as being a blocker has presented strategy to formations with extra limited finishes and extensive receivers, who may very well be identified as on to dam in the course of working performs. The significantly widespread ace development replaces the fullback with an additional receiver, who strains up together the line of scrimmage. The I'll usually be utilised Briefly-yardage and purpose line conditions.

Solitary set Back again
One set back is a foundation development in American Soccer employed by the offensive team which needs just one working back again powering the quarterback. There are plenty of versions on one back again formations which include two tight ends and two extensive receivers, 1 tight end/three large receivers, and many others. The working back again can line up directly driving the quarterback or offset possibly the weak aspect (faraway from the tight stop) or maybe the solid side(in the direction of the tight conclusion).
